Charcoal is one of the first tools humans used to make artwork, appearing in cave paintings dating back 28,000 years. Charcoal was one of the favourite artistic materials used for sketches by sandro botticelli and leonardo da vinci. Charcoal is made from twigs of willow or vine that have been heated at a high temperature in an enclosed vessel without oxygen. This process yields a solid drawing stick that. Charcoal as an art medium is known for its rich, deep tones and expressive qualities. There are various types and uses of charcoal as an art medium, but the commonly used types are:
